虚拟化技术在软件方面,如微软的Hyper-v和virtual Server 2005 R2,咱们能够这样去描述它,能够说是把物理系统资源的抽象,使得能够更多的去建立基于逻辑分区的操做系统.每一套都是异构环境.同时运行在同一台服务器上.每一个逻辑分区,也称之为一个虚拟机,是软件环境使用共同的资源(如仿真硬件,或者其它设备).在这操做系统里面,咱们能够去安装和运行一个或者多个应用程序.尽管,虚拟化技术已经积极的采用基于X-86的IT环境,但,也是最近10年的事情.其实该技术最先出现时40年前.商业级的虚拟化技术构思是IBM在1960s运用在System/360模型67硬件上,让多个ma-chines可以运行在单用户的操做系统上.IBM公司开发完成这两个独立的操做系统,虚拟机(VM)和会话监控系统(CMS),一般被称为VM/CMS.VM用来建立控制虚拟机,CMS单用户操做系统,运行在虚拟机内,为每一个用户提供访问底层的系统资源.直到如今,IBM公司继续开发VM(该名称z/VM).在过去的十年中,虚拟化技术研究和产品开发已死灰复燃,在x86(32位和64位的重点)平台.2006年,AMD和英特尔发布X86处理器新的指示和具体目标,使处理器的扩展修改,硬件辅助虚拟化.虽然各方在实施细节,AMD公司虚拟化技术(AMD - V)和英特尔虚拟技术(VT)提供硬件虚拟化,能够由软件供应商利用虚拟化来简化他们的软件功能.代码和扩展其虚拟化解决方案架构.在2007年和2008年,加强的AMD - V和英特尔VT的 64位双核和四核,处理器有一个利于Hyper - V的代码的影响.事实上,微软和其余虚拟化软件供应商继续与AMD和英特尔合做,以肯定对将来的处理器优化和改善.
PS:我尽可能天天发一篇,翻译的不是很好.见谅~!有啥纯技术方面的问题,请到
VTSINO找我.